Our client is seeking an experienced payments professional, for an initial five-month contract, to provide strategic and operational expertise across merchant acceptance, payment gateways, acquiring, and Pay Fac ecosystems.

This role requires a strong understanding of the UK & Ireland payments landscape, with particular emphasis on gateway and merchant-side payments experience.

The successful candidate will combine deep industry knowledge with an understanding of the regulatory, commercial, and technology trends shaping the future of merchant payments.

Key Responsibilities

  • Provide subject matter expertise across payment gateways, merchant acceptance, acquiring, and Pay Fac models.
  • Support the assessment and optimisation of merchant payment journeys, acceptance performance, and customer experience.
  • Advise on gateway, acquiring, and acceptance strategies for merchants across SME, Mid-Corp, and Enterprise segments.
  • Support engagement with acquirers, gateways, Pay Facs, ISVs, and payment technology partners.
  • Provide insight into emerging payment technologies and industry developments, including PSD3, Network Tokenisation, Agentic Commerce, and B2B payments.
  • Translate regulatory requirements, including PSD2, PSD3, and Consumer Duty, into actionable business recommendations.
  • Collaborate with product, technology, operations, compliance, and commercial teams to deliver acceptance-related initiatives.
  • Develop stakeholder materials, strategic recommendations, and market insights.
